Description
The government is looking to strengthen resilience of its population and address issues of poverty and youth unemployment by a strategy focused on:
- improving the labour market relevance of skills in selected sectors
- increasing the efficiency and coverage of the Social Protection (SP) system
To achieve these objectives, it is focusing on 2 components:
- technical and Vocational Education and Training (TVET), which concentrates on the promotion of higher quality technical and socio-emotional skills and the transformation of the TVET sector from a supply-driven system to a demand-driven system that responds to the labour market
- strengthening social protection policy frameworks and improving the implementation of flagship social programs with an emphasis on increasing the efficiency and coverage of the Public Assistance Programme (PAP), Saint Lucia’s main cash transfer programme
